Understanding Solar Powered Robot Kits

When I first delved into the world of solar powered robot kits, I was fascinated by how they combine technology with renewable energy. These kits allow me to build and customize my own robots using solar energy, making them eco-friendly and educational. I’ve discovered that they not only promote creativity but also teach essential STEM (Science, Technology, Engineering, and Mathematics) concepts.

Key Features to Consider

As I began my search, I realized there are several key features to keep in mind. First, I looked at the types of robots I could build. Some kits offer multiple designs, while others focus on a single model. Additionally, I considered the complexity of the assembly process. Some kits are beginner-friendly, while others are more advanced, requiring greater technical skills.

Another feature that caught my attention was the solar panel’s efficiency. A good solar panel can significantly enhance the robot’s performance. I also noted the materials used in the kit. Durable and lightweight materials tend to yield better results, especially for outdoor use.

Age Appropriateness

When selecting a solar powered robot kit, I made sure to consider the age of the user. Some kits are designed for younger children, while others are more suited for teenagers or adults. Understanding the target age group helped me choose a kit that would be both challenging and enjoyable.
